The Acellular Dermal Matrices Market provides tissue reinforcement materials that are processed and decellularized to remove antigenic cellular components. These matrices are composed primarily of collagen, elastin and other proteins that boost the native regenerative properties to improve tissue repair. The acellular dermal matrices aid in wound closure, reinforce soft tissue flaps or grafts and prevent post-operative herniation. They offer significant improvement over synthetic meshes by reducing inflammatory response and infection risks.

Market key trends

The growing demand for advanced wound care solutions is one of the key trends in the Acellular Dermal Matrices Market Demand . These matrices act as scaffolds that promote cellular infiltration, angiogenesis and collagen deposition to expedite wound healing. Their ability to reform soft tissue structure with minimal scarring makes them increasingly popular in reconstructive and cosmetic surgeries.
